District Context — LE12
LE12 covers Ashby-de-la-Zouch and surrounding villages in north-west Leicestershire, positioned between Leicester and Burton upon Trent. The area combines market-town character with rural appeal, drawing both families and those seeking a quieter pace of life outside the major conurbations.
